Day 2 : Munnar

Begin your day with a refreshing breakfast and set out to explore the romantic hill station of Munnar, a highlight of your 6 nights 7 days Kerala tour package.Your first stop is Eravikulam National Park, home to the endangered Nilgiri Tahr and a diverse range of rare flora and fauna – a must-visit on any Kerala sightseeing tour. Next, visit the picturesque Mattupetty Dam, perched at 1,800 meters above sea level, followed by a trip to Echo Point, where the hills delightfully return your voice.

Continue to the Tea Museum (closed on Mondays), a favourite among families and tea lovers. Learn about the fascinating process of tea-making through vintage photographs and machines – a great educational experience for kids and adults alike.Wrap up your day with a peaceful stroll through the misty landscapes and tea-scented air, a serene moment that defines the essence of a delighted Kerala tour.Overnight stay in Munnar.

Pack light cotton clothes for the coast and backwaters, and light woollens for hill stations like Munnar. Don’t forget comfortable walking shoes, sunscreen, and a hat.

Yes, Kerala offers plenty of vegetarian dishes, including Sadya (traditional meal), Appam with vegetable stew, Avial, and more. Special dietary preferences can also be arranged.
